Purification and Zakat (for long-term investing) calculations are in USD per share and based on AAOIFI methodology. AAOIFI requires purification every financial period (e.g. quarterly).
If you follow S&P Shariah’s Dividend-only purification, then remove the impure income % from the dividends you receive. No purification required for non-dividend paying stocks, according to S&P Shariah.
For Zakat, if you did not invest in a company from a long term perspective, then consider the shares as trading goods and give 2.5% of the total value if a year has passed on them.
Company Profile
CTP NV is a Netherlands-based commercial real estate developer managing and delivering business parks mainly throughout Central and Eastern Europe, the Netherlands, Austria and Germany. The activities of the Company and its subsidiaries are divided into six operating segments: Czech Republic, Romania, Hungary, Slovakia, The Netherlands and Hotel Segment. Czech Republic inludes Industrial property, offices and retail. The business segments Romania, Hungary and Slovakia are engaged in Industrial property business. The Netherlands segment is involved in Industrial property and Development. The Hotel segment operates three hotels under the Courtyard by Marriott brand in the Czech Republic: Prague Airport, Pilsen and Brno.
